Output 758a26005d331e25a2d38fe661028bf155333c7816de8fb4d0b323c4b2b92c46:0

value
29464093
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7a90485c4505e718a96cb3ed7e9cf40474ba22d0 OP_EQUALVERIFY OP_CHECKSIG
address
1CB4HLcUixU5YS3YTtopskwqvpWKHTG5XW
transaction
758a26005d331e25a2d38fe661028bf155333c7816de8fb4d0b323c4b2b92c46
spent
true